Purity: Ruling on Clothing Washed with Kurr or Flowing Water When Sludge Is Found
Practical Laws of Islam as per the teachings of Ayatullah Sistani
Ruling 162
If clothing is washed with kurr or flowing water and afterwards some sludge, for example, is found on it, in the event that one does not deem it probable for it to have prevented the water from reaching the clothing, the clothing is pure.
-Ayatullah Sistani, Practical Laws of Islam, Purification (Taharah)
